Transaction 59d5cbaae9b1920ce17170c405df3c250cc576b098d4140f3aec99077f09ce39

1 Input
2 Outputs
  • 59d5cbaae9b1920ce17170c405df3c250cc576b098d4140f3aec99077f09ce39:0
  • value  72674
    address  3E9zHmcr8Y4ugPsDxSTvqxcnj17RhXnfeg
  • 59d5cbaae9b1920ce17170c405df3c250cc576b098d4140f3aec99077f09ce39:1
  • value  3898554341
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x